I can't imagine why Korean girls would wear hanbok (the traditional dresses) to school in Japan, when they don't wear them to school in Korea. Hanbok are for special occasions, and most women don't own one until well into their twenties.

And bullies? Please, they (or students like them) get bullied every day in Korean schools. The stresses placed on students in Korea (mostly to get into good high schools and universities) are just as bad as they are in Japan. Stress + school = bullies.
